Understanding the Legalities of Electric Bike Usage

When it comes to riding electric bikes on the road, it’s important to have a clear understanding of the legalities involved. While electric bikes are growing in popularity as an eco-friendly and convenient mode of transportation, there are certain regulations that need to be followed to ensure safety and compliance with the law.

Here are a few key points to consider:

  1. Classification: Electric bikes, also known as e-bikes, come in different classifications based on their maximum speed and power output. In most jurisdictions, e-bikes fall into three main categories – Class 1, Class 2, and Class 3. Each class has its own set of regulations regarding speed limits, motor power, and pedal-assist requirements.
  2. Speed Limits: The maximum speed at which you can ride an electric bike on public roads varies depending on the classification. Generally, Class 1 and Class 2 e-bikes have a top speed limit of around 20 mph (32 km/h), while Class 3 e-bikes may reach speeds up to 28 mph (45 km/h). It’s crucial to adhere to these speed limits for your safety and the safety of others sharing the road.
  3. Age Restrictions: Some jurisdictions impose age restrictions for riding electric bikes on public roads. For example, riders under a certain age may be required to wear helmets or may not be allowed to operate certain classes of e-bikes altogether. Familiarize yourself with your local laws regarding age restrictions before hitting the road.
  4. Licensing and Registration: In many places, electric bikes do not require a license or registration like motorcycles or cars do. However, specific regions may have their own regulations regarding licensing requirements for operating certain classes of e-bikes on public roads. Be sure to check your local laws regarding licensing and registration obligations.
  5. Bicycle Infrastructure: While electric bikes are generally allowed on most roads, it’s important to be aware of any local restrictions or regulations regarding bicycle infrastructure. Some areas may have designated bike lanes or paths where cyclists, including e-bike riders, are encouraged to ride for their safety and the convenience of other road users.

    Choosing the Right Electric Bike for Road Use

When it comes to selecting the perfect electric bike for road use, there are several factors to consider. Here are a few key points to keep in mind:

  1. Power and Speed: Look for an electric bike that offers sufficient power and speed capabilities for road riding. Consider the motor’s wattage and torque, as well as the maximum speed it can reach. Opting for a bike with a more powerful motor will ensure smoother acceleration and better performance on roads.
  2. Battery Range: The battery range is an essential factor when choosing an electric bike for road use. Evaluate how far you typically ride and choose a bike with a battery that can provide adequate range without needing frequent recharging or running out of power during your rides.
  3. Tire Size and Type: Pay attention to the size and type of tires on the electric bike. For road use, narrower tires with less tread tend to be more suitable as they offer lower rolling resistance, allowing you to glide smoothly over paved surfaces.
  4. Frame Design: Consider the frame design of the electric bike, particularly if you plan on using it primarily on roads. A lightweight frame made from materials like aluminum or carbon fiber can enhance maneuverability and make your ride more enjoyable.
  5. Comfort Features: Look for comfort features such as adjustable handlebars, suspension forks, or padded seats that can contribute to a smooth and comfortable ride on various road surfaces.

Maintenance Tips to Keep Your Electric Bike Roadworthy

Taking proper care of your electric bike is crucial to ensure its optimal performance and longevity. Here are some maintenance tips that will help you keep your electric bike roadworthy:

  1. Regular Cleaning: It’s essential to clean your electric bike regularly, especially after riding in wet or muddy conditions. Use a mild detergent and water to gently wash the frame, wheels, and components. Avoid using high-pressure water as it can damage sensitive electrical parts.
  2. Tire Maintenance: Check your tire pressure frequently and make sure they are inflated to the recommended level specified by the manufacturer. Properly inflated tires not only provide better traction but also reduce the risk of flats and improve battery efficiency.
  3. Battery Care: The battery is one of the most critical components of an electric bike. Follow these guidelines to maintain its performance:
  • Keep the battery charged between 20% and 80% for optimal lifespan.
  • Store the battery in a cool and dry place when not in use.
  • Avoid exposing the battery to extreme temperatures or direct sunlight.
  1. Lubrication: Keeping your electric bike properly lubricated is key to smooth operation and preventing wear on moving parts. Apply lubricant regularly to the chain, derailleurs, and other drivetrain components as recommended by the manufacturer.
  2. Brake Inspection: Ensure that your brakes are functioning correctly by inspecting them regularly. Look for any signs of wear on brake pads or cables and adjust them if necessary. Properly functioning brakes are vital for ensuring your safety while riding on roads.
